Occupying a pleasant position overlooking the Reabrook nature reserve, this is a spacious and well presented three bedroom semi- detached house. The property is within walking distance of a variety of local amenities, schooling etc and is well placed for easy access to the Shrewsbury town centre and local bypass linking up to the M54 motorway network. Accommodation - Entrance hall, lounge, attractive spacious family/kitchen/diner, sitting room, laundry area, first floor landing, three bedrooms, bathroom, front and rear enclosed gardens, driveway good size garage, double glazing, gas fired central heating. Viewing is recommended.

Upvc double glazed entrance door gives access to:

Entrance Porch/Hall - Having tiled floor, glazed window.

Part glazed door then gives access to:

Lounge - 5.13m x 3.63m (16'10 x 11'11) - Having upvc double glazed window with pleasing aspect to front, radiator, wood effect flooring, under-stairs recess.

Doorway from lounge gives access to:

Attractive Spacious Family/Kitchen/Diner - 5.11m x 3.20m (16'9 x 10'6) - Having a range of eye level and base units with built-in cupboards and drawers, space for appliances, fitted worktops with inset 1 1/2 stainless steel sink drainer unit with mixer tap over, upvc double glazed window to side, wall hung stainless steel finish cooker extractor fan, plate rack, corner display unit, glass display cabinet, radiator, tiled floor, coving to ceiling.

Doorway from kitchen/diner gives access to:

Sitting Room - 3.35m x 3.30m (11'0 x 10'10) - Having sealed unit double glazed folding doors giving access to rear gardens, tiled floor, radiator, fitted storage cupboards, display shelving.

Door from sitting room gives access to:

Laundry Area - 3.43m x 1.52m (11'3 x 5'0) - Having space for washing machine, fitted worktop, base unit, wall mounted gas fired central heating boiler, service door to garage.

From lounge stairs rise to:

First Floor Landing - Having upvc double glazed window to side, loft access, linen store cupboard.

Doors from first floor landing then give access to: All bedrooms and bathroom.

Bedroom One - 3.43m x 2.90m (11'3 x 9'6) - Having upvc double glazed window with pleasing aspect to the Reabrook nature reserve, radiator, eye level store cupboards.

Bedroom Two - 3.20m x 2.92m (10'6 x 9'7) - Having upvc double glazed window to rear, radiator.

Bedroom Three - 2.59m max reducing down to 2.18m (8'6 max reducin - Having upvc double glazed window with pleasing aspect towards the Reabrook nature reserve, display shelved unit, radiator.

Bathroom - Having a three piece white suite comprising: panelled bath with electric shower over, pedestal wash hand basin, low flush WC, vinyl tiled effect floor covering, heated chrome style towel rail, fully tiled to walls, double glazed window to rear.

Outside - To the front of the property there is lawned garden with inset shrubs, paved patio area. To the side of this there is a driveway which gives access to:

Garage - 4.75m x 3.48m (15'7 x 11'5) - Having twin timber double doors.

Rear Gardens - To the rear of the property there is a pleasant garden having paved patio area, lawned gardens, raised decked area, inset shrubs and plants. The rear gardens are enclosed by fencing and brick walling.
